A Veterans Disability Attorney Can Help You Get the Benefits You Deserve

A lawyer for veterans with disabilities can help you appeal a decision made by the Department of veterans disability attorneys Affairs. You may request a Higher Level Review or appeal to the Board of Veterans Appeals.

The VA claims process can be long. Oftentimes, you'll have to attend an hearing. It could be an DRO hearing, the BVA hearing, or the Court of Appeals for Veterans Claims.

The monetary compensation you receive from the VA is contingent on your disability rating which is a percentage that is based on the extent to which your condition interferes with your ability to work and complete daily tasks. The higher your rating, more you'll earn. A veteran disability attorney can help you get the medical documentation you need to secure a high rating and also your right to TDIU.

A qualified disability lawyer can also give you an idea of whether you're eligible for military-specific credits, which can increase your Social Security income. These are credits dependent on the type of service you've rendered to the nation and are an essential element of your claim for disability. A professional can help with appeals, which are typically required when you receive an unsatisfactory decision from the VA. They can assist you in filing a notice of dispute and represent you in hearings before decision-review officers as well as a veterans law judge.
